Recently, I was talking to a person who was working their way through the grief of losing someone they love. We were talking about what has helped them the most and they said, “people just showing up to hang out with me.” It reminded me that presence is powerful.
This fall, we have been studying the book of Job at The Gathering. Most of the book is about Job’s friends trying to make him feel better with banal sentiments, insensitive explanations, and occasionally frustrated accusations. Unsurprisingly, none of this helps Job! But the friends weren’t all bad. Before they started trying to fix Job’s grief, the book said that they just sat with Job.
They sat with Job on the ground seven days and seven nights, not speaking a word to him, for they saw that he was in excruciating pain. (Job 2.13)
The story said that their very presence was a comfort and consolation. Presence is powerful.
